    Interview with Signiant about Remote Hybrid Working, Cloud vs On-Prem and its Media Engine Platform

    Interview with Signiant about Remote Hybrid Working, Cloud vs On-Prem and its Media Engine Platform

    We are joined with Scott Wall from Signiant, as we explore remote hybrid working and the challenges that media operations teams are faced with when managing the distribution workforces. In this discussion, we investigate cloud vs on prem storage and specific workflows where cloud can be more successful.

    Additionally, we take a look at Signiant's new platform, Media Engine, which was announced last year. Discover how this service plays into helping remote team collaboration.

    Episode 11: Cloud Networking: Considerations & Best Practices

    Episode 11: Cloud Networking: Considerations & Best Practices

    Hybrid Cloud? Multi-Cloud? Cloud Native? Whether you're already there or planning to migrate, it's critical to understand the networking implications that can have a big impact on your happiness. In this episode, Jim talks to networking expert Aniket Daptari who shares key architectural considerations and best practices to help minimize the bumps you may encounter in your cloud journey.
